首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

动态检查成员资格swi-prolog

动态检查成员资格(Dynamic Checking of Membership)是一种在编程中用于判断某个元素是否属于某个集合的技术。在云计算领域中,动态检查成员资格常用于处理大规模数据集合,以提高数据处理的效率和准确性。

动态检查成员资格可以通过编程语言提供的相关函数或算法来实现。在前端开发中,可以使用JavaScript的Array.includes()方法来检查数组中是否包含某个元素。在后端开发中,可以使用Python的in关键字来判断某个元素是否存在于列表、集合或字典中。

动态检查成员资格的优势在于可以快速准确地判断某个元素是否属于某个集合,从而方便进行后续的数据处理和逻辑判断。它可以帮助开发人员简化代码逻辑,提高代码的可读性和可维护性。

动态检查成员资格在云计算中的应用场景非常广泛。例如,在用户管理系统中,可以使用动态检查成员资格来验证用户输入的用户名是否已经存在于数据库中。在数据分析和机器学习领域,可以使用动态检查成员资格来判断某个数据点是否属于某个聚类或分类。

腾讯云提供了多个相关产品和服务,可以帮助开发人员实现动态检查成员资格的功能。例如,腾讯云的云函数(Serverless Cloud Function)可以用于编写和部署无服务器函数,从而实现动态检查成员资格的逻辑。此外,腾讯云的云数据库(TencentDB)和云存储(COS)等产品也可以用于存储和管理数据集合。

更多关于腾讯云相关产品和服务的介绍,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Paxos理论介绍(4): 动态成员变更

也就是说,固定的成员是Paxos算法的根基。 人肉配置进行成员变更?...再根据上文,我们得出一个要求,在相同的实例上,我们要求各个成员所认为的成员集合必须是一致的,也就是在一次完整的Paxos算法里面,成员其实还是固定的。 每个成员如何得知这个成员集合是什么?...况且,我们接下来要介绍的动态成员变更算法也是非常的简单。所以这些细致的问题就不展开来聊了。...Paxos动态成员变更算法 这个算法在 Paxos Made Simple 的最后一段被一句话带过,可能作者认为这个是水到渠成的事情,根本不值一提。...那么非常水到渠成的事情就是,成员(投票者集合)本身也是一个状态,我们通过Paxos来决议出成员变更的操作系列,那么各台机器就能获得一致的成员状态。如下图。

69120
  • lua调用c语言so动态库--以waf中证书检查为例

    ​ 需求 在基于nginx做waf开发时,nginx+lua+c动态库是常见的开发模式,在lua生态无法满足需求时,就需要我们在lua代码中调用动态库的方式,进行扩展,下面以lua调用c语言+openssl...动态库的方式,进行判断证书的创建时间和证书的过期时间为例,进行说明 由于lua没有openss sdk做证书检查校验工作,那么就需要我们基于c语言和openssl库些一个so动态库,以供lua调用去判断证书有效时间...{"expire_cert_time", expire_cert_time}, {NULL,NULL} }; c库入口函数 通过luaopen_xxx实现,xxx标识c函数封装so动态库的名称...,该例中动态库名称为libcert.so,固函数名为luaopen_libcert,luaL_register参数为lua_State、动态库名称libcert、上面luaL_Reg lib。...int luaopen_libcert(lua_State *L) { luaL_register(L,"libcert",lib); return 1; } lua代码调用c动态

    1.8K30

    迁移学习与图神经网络“合力”模型:用DoT-GNN克服组重识别难题

    如图1所示,当组从摄像机A移到摄像机B时,1)人们改变了他们在组中的位置(称为组布局更改),2)一些人动态加入并离开了组(称为组成员资格更改)。...本文的图生成器会采用两种策略来构造图样本,即成员资格保留组和成员资格可变组。 成员资格保留组(Membership-preserving grouping) 本文使用迁移的图特征来代替图样本。...因此,作者提出了一种保留成员资格的分组策略,针对图像类Lx,作者首先随机选取一些人作为其成员。然后,针对每一个成员,再随机选择一个与其相关联的节点。...消融实验对比 其中Tr.表示域迁移模型,S1表示成员资格保留组策略,S2表示成员资格可变组策略,GNN表示图网络。 ? 总结 在本文中,作者解决了一个重要但研究较少的问题:组重识别。...本文提出使用图节点生成(迁移),成员资格保留组和成员资格更改组来分别克服组重标识中的三个主要挑战:训练数据不足,布局和外在更改以及成员资格导致的布局更改。

    1.4K20

    从零开始学PostgreSQL (四): 数据库角色

    角色成员资格: 角色可以是另一个角色的成员,这允许角色继承其父角色的权限。例如,创建一个新的角色并将其添加到 pg_read_all_data 角色中,那么新角色将自动获得读取所有数据的能力。...角色可能是其他角色的成员成员资格的基础,因此需要处理好依赖关系。 数据库角色与属性 从概念上讲,数据库角色与操作系统用户完全分开。在实践中,保持通信可能很方便,但这不是必需的。...2.超级用户状态 数据库超级用户可以绕过所有权限检查,但不能绕过登录权限检查。这是一个危险的特权,应谨慎使用,最好大部分工作以非超级用户的角色进行。...CREATE 角色成员资格 在 PostgreSQL 中,角色成员资格的管理是通过创建角色并使用 GRANT 和 REVOKE 命令来实现的。....; 授予组角色的成员资格:组角色和非组角色之间没有本质区别,因此可以向其他组角色授予成员身份。

    16310

    OOP驾考预约(单继承)

    题目描述 某驾校对学车的学员做出以下设计: (1)定义CPerson类,包含数据成员:姓名,联系电话。由CPerson作为基类派生出学员类。...(2)学员类表示普通学员,他们可以在场地A练车,一天最多获得一个学时(即使练习时长超过一小时也只能按一个学时计算) 学员类新增一个数据成员Atime,长度为12的整数数组,表示连续12天,在A场地每天练习的时长...,时长单位按分钟计算 学员类新增一个成员函数void check(),检查学员是否达到预约科目二考试资格的标准,并输出相应提示信息。...预约资格是:在每12天的周期内,总学时达到10小时可以预约。...VIP学员类新增一个数据成员Btime,长度为12的整数数组,表示连续12天中,在B场地每天练习的时长,时长单位按分钟计算 VIP学员类重载函数void check(),功能也是检查预约资格,只是学时计算要包含

    13610

    4.路由器技术

    主要有 3 种应用方式:动态地址转换、静态地址转换、网络地址端口转换NART。 2.NAT三种应用方式 (1)动态NAT: 多对少(m>=n & m>=1)情况下。 m 代表内部网络地址。...一个组播包含多个成员,当组播服务发送信息时需要发送 1 个分组 。 3.常用IP组播地址 ? 常用IP组播地址.png 4.组播与MAC映射 把组地址的低23位复制到以太网地址中 ?...IGMPv3的3种报文格式.png ① 成员资格询问报文 组播路由发出,询问是否有主机加入组播。 ② 成员资格报告报文 主机加入组播。 ③ 组记录报文 记录组播的状态和信息。...适用于组播成员数量多,成员集中的情况。 主动发送的方式。 (2)稀疏模式路由协议 适用于宽带小、组播成员分布稀疏的互联网络。 采用选择性的建立和维护分布树。

    68010

    组复制系统变量 | 全方位认识 MySQL 8.0 Group Replication

    当组中有成员处于故障恢复中时,通过该系统变量为成员指定一个最小配额,可以避免组中的正常成员出现性能大幅抖动),它与上一个流量控制检查周期中所计算出的最小配额无关。...此系统变量用于强制创建新的组成员资格,其中被排除的成员(未写进该系统变量中的成员)在该变量设置成功之后就不会收到新视图消息且会被阻塞(阻塞写入操作)。...组复制的组通信引擎(XCom)将检查所提供的IP地址是否为有效格式,并检查是否包含了当前无法访问的Server。...在强制执行新的成员资格配置之前,必须确保要被排除在外的组成员的Server已经关闭,这一点很重要。如果没有关闭,请在设置该系统变量之前将其关闭。...因为,如果被排除的组成员仍然在线,那么,当使用该系统变量强制设置新的组成员资格时,被排除的组成员可能会自动形成新的组成员资格,即,该强制成员资格的配置操作导致组发生了人为的脑裂。

    1.5K21

    群组复制MySQL Group Replication

    群组复制包括一个内置的组成员资格服务,可以使群组的视图保持一致,并且在任何给定时间点均可用于所有服务器。服务器可以离开并加入该组,视图将相应更新。...如果存在网络分区,导致成员无法达成协议,那么系统将无法继续运行。 所有这些均由群组通信系统(GCS)协议提供支持。它提供故障检测机制,组成员资格服务以及安全有序的消息传递。...为了防止这种情况,当新成员加入(包括之前已升级并重新启动的成员)时,该成员将对组中的其余成员进行兼容性检查。 这些兼容性检查的结果在多主模式下尤其重要。...群组复制具有组成员资格服务,该服务定义了哪些服务器处于联机状态并参与该组。联机服务器列表称为视图。组中的每台服务器都具有一致的视图,即在给定的时间哪些成员是积极参与组的服务器。...如果服务器自愿离开该组,则该组将重新动态排列其配置,并触发视图更改。 在成员自愿离开组的情况下,它首先启动动态组重新配置,在此期间,所有成员必须在不离开服务器的情况下就新视图达成一致。

    1.4K21

    腾讯发布国内首个云原生加速器,30个成员席位虚位以待!|腾讯产业加速器·动态

    云原生凭借敏捷、开放、标准化的特点,将云计算的优势进一步拓宽,轻量化、松耦合、灵活的技术架构特点,对各企业在公有云、私有云和混合云等新型动态环境中,构建和运行可弹性扩展的应用,都起到了很大的帮助。...2 资金层面 云原生加速器对接腾讯产业生态投资,联合一线VC机构,为成员提供多渠道资本扶持,提高资本对接效率。...3 行业层面 腾讯云将提供“商机+流量”导入,为成员提供多元合作模式与商业机会,拓展云原生应用场景,加快更多行业向云原生环境迁移。...4 资源层面 入选成员将成为腾讯云原生、腾讯云安全、腾讯AI实验室、边缘计算实验室、优图实验室等先进技术合作伙伴,收获更多合作机会。...除导师辅助外,入选成员还将获得一年期立体孵化,通过4次闭门交流+1次海外产业探访+N次业务及资源对接,完成技术、资源与合作等全方位持续赋能。

    1.7K30
    领券